Tributes have poured in for the victim of a tragic shooting incident in Camden.
Authorities responded to reports of gunfire around 23:00 hours on Saturday, March 28, on Chalton Street. Despite the efforts of emergency medical personnel, a 26-year-old man was pronounced dead at the scene.
Following a post-mortem examination conducted earlier today, March 31, the victim has been officially identified as Nahom Medhanie.
Nahom’s family, who are receiving support from specialized officers, expressed their grief in a heartfelt tribute:
“Nahom was more than a son and a brother to us, and since his passing, these have been the hardest days of our lives. He was funny, honest, and would just light up the room with his presence, and that’s what we loved most about him.”
The family has requested privacy during this difficult time.
The investigation is being led by homicide detectives from the Metropolitan Police’s Specialist Crime Command. CCTV footage indicates that Nahom was shot multiple times while seated in a white Nissan Juke, with the assailant arriving and departing on a bicycle.
As inquiries continue, no arrests have been made thus far. Authorities are urging anyone with information to reach out to the police by calling 101 and quoting CAD 8032/28MAR, or to contact Crimestoppers anonymously at 0800 555 111.
